Design optimization: Topology and much more
Topology optimization and its seductive biomorphic shapes are what many think of when they hear the word “optimization” in engineering design. But topology optimization is just one kind of structural optimization—and that, in turn, is only one of five broad classes of optimization technology available to engineers today.
